An exciting opportunity has arisen for an Interim SENDCO position in this innovative and ambitious school. As the numbers of children with SEND have increased in the mainstream school, the Governing Body is seeking to appoint an experienced and highly skilled teacher, or retired Head/SLT to join the inclusion team as the Interim SENDCO across mainstream (Yr1-6) and Woodlands. This role will collaborate with the current Interim Lead SENDCO (EYFS) and the Woodlands SEND team. We are looking for someone who is passionate about teaching, is creative and hard working with excellent organisational and digital skills. This role will be based across the Netley mainstream (Yr1-6) initially for a 1 year fixed term contract, while the long term needs of the school are considered. MPS/UPS + SEND allowance & TLR2 Part-time (ideally 3 days per week- can be negotiated depending on experience of candidates)
Netley Primary School is an inclusive school, exuding a warmth and generosity of spirit that comes from our happy children and diverse school community. The school is set within Netley Campus, a state-of-the-art learning environment for children and adults. We have 380 children, including Woodlands, a centre for children with Autism. In 2024 OFSTED judged both Netley and Woodlands as ‘Outstanding’ in 4 of 5 categories, and commented; “Pupils with special educational needs and/or disabilities (SEND) are extremely well supported. Throughout the school, pupils work hard, listen carefully and are proud of their achievements”.
